LOS ANGELES, Jan. 26,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Mission, a managed cloud services provider and Amazon Web Services (AWS) Premier Consulting Partner, today announced that Dr. Ryan Ries has joined Mission as the Practice Lead for its new Data Science & Engineering organization. Dr. Ries will be responsible for building and leading the new practice, which will be a part of Mission’s expanded Professional Consulting Services for businesses of all sizes using AWS.

Dr. Ries is a renowned data scientist bringing Mission more than 15 years of data and engineering leadership at fast-scaling technology companies. Over his career, Dr. Ries has helped develop cutting-edge data solutions for customers ranging from the U.S. Department of Defense and other government entities to one of the largest online retailers and a myriad of Fortune 500 companies. Most recently, Dr. Ries served as the Senior Director of Data Science & Engineering at Onica (acquired by Rackspace), where he built out the business’ data practice. While growing his team of data scientists and engineers by nearly 800% in two years, Dr. Ries focused on customers’ AWS data migration and data modernization initiatives. His work routinely leveraged AI and machine learning to unlock new data-driven insights that could deliver deeper value across organizations. For example, Dr. Ries built out algorithms for one of the world's largest online retailers analyzing billions of shipments to better match products and shipping package types, increasing cost efficiencies. Prior to Onica, Dr. Ries served for ten years at Areté Associates, the national defense-focused science and engineering company. Dr. Ries earned his Ph.D. in Biophysical Chemistry at UCLA and Caltech.
